Originally posted by Mr Bean View PostIf I were looking to buy a wagon in Ontario where would be the best place to look? I haven't seen one for sale in ages.
Kijiji is your best bet really. Search the entire Ontario section, not just by city, and filter 79-91 years with a make only. Don't try to filter by anything else, people far too often screw up the body style and model selections.
